In 1920, Helen Ramsey Nelson entered the world in Mars Hill, Madison County, North Carolina, United States of America, born to Obie Clarence Ramsey And Winifred Davis Carter Ramsey. In 1935, Helen Ramsey Nelson resided in Rural, Hamilton, Tennessee. In 1940, Helen Ramsey Nelson resided in Township 15, Madison, North Carolina, USA. Helen Ramsey Nelson married Joseph Jerry Nelson, and had children including Dale Nelson, Debbie And Her Husband Dennis Nelson Wierich, Jim Nelson And His Wife Ellen Nelson, Kathy And Her Husband Kim Nelson Bishhop, Pattie Nelson Hobson. Helen Ramsey Nelson passed away in 2009 in Longview, Cowlitz County, Washington, United States of America.
